Historic Visby

Historic Visby

Visby is a remarkably preserved medieval trading center on the island of Gotland and a UNESCO World Heritage site. The town is defined by its 13th-century limestone ring wall, which stretches nearly 3.5 kilometers and includes numerous defensive towers and gates. This collection features key architectural remains, including the oldest tower in the fortifications, prehistoric stone labyrinths, and gates that once connected the Hanseatic hub to its surrounding hospitals and countryside.

Historic Churches and Ruins

Historic Churches and Ruins

Visby’s UNESCO-listed cityscape is defined by its concentration of medieval religious architecture. This collection features the 13th-century Saint Mary's Cathedral, the only medieval church still in active use, alongside several atmospheric ruins. Highlights include the Franciscan St. Katarina with its soaring arches, the Dominican St. Nicolai known for its acoustics, and the unique dual ruins of Sankt Hans and Sankt Pers. These structures showcase diverse architectural styles, from Byzantine influences at Drottens to the defensive wall-passages of St. Lawrence, reflecting the city’s Hanseatic wealth.

Parks and Gardens

Parks and Gardens

Visby’s green spaces blend medieval history with diverse horticulture. The DBW’s Botanical Garden features exotic species protected by the city’s mild coastal climate, while Almedalen marks the site of the original medieval harbor. Surrounding the UNESCO-listed city walls, the expansive moats of Östergravar and Nordergravar provide preserved defensive landscapes. This selection includes historic squares like Packhusplan and the Valdemarskorset memorial, reflecting Visby’s transition from a Hanseatic trading hub to a modern cultural center.
